Precautions & Warnings
Parenteral fluids, as well as oral saline, may be needed to replace depressed renal function, severe ongoing diarrhoea, or other important fluid losses. Acetate or gluconate ion-containing solutions should be used with caution, as too much of them can cause metabolic alkalosis. Dextrose-containing solutions should be used with caution in individuals who have diabetes mellitus, whether subclinical or overt.
